I was out hill walking at the weekend and got talking with someone who has been walking the Camino Frances one week at a time.  She was telling me that they are due to start again in September sometime, they had their flights booked – but they were having problems getting from Santander to Fromista.

Most people get surprised once they start investigating to discover how good the Spanish transport network is.  The train and bus service is generally of a very high standard and from my own experience they normally run on time.

Any back to getting to Fromista – follow this link to see the time table.

I was making the mistake of thinking that it would be better to travel to Burgos and get to Fromista from there – but no.  The best train to get is the train that goes to Palencia as the local train passes through Fromista.
